The bastions built on this fort, that much resembles those on a castle, are located on the northeast and southwest corners of the fort. This view overlooks the fort complex from the southwest bastion. The bastions were built for defense and protection of the fort. The watchtower, with its flagpole attached, served as a guard post above the main gate of the fort. Although each round bastion was equipped with a swivel cannon, the cannons were never used for defense, but used for signaling and welcoming arriving trade caravans. As with the first image in this series of images, the fort does in fact look like an ancient castle, with a little southwest adobe flair....
